Wow, I can't believe it's already been a month since I updated my blog!  Since returning from my support raising trip to Texas, things here in GA have been in constant motion.  It's funny as I read the titles of my friends and co-workers blogs and their Facebook statuses, the common word seems to be "whirlwind."  But it's a great whirlwind that we consistently find ourselves in.

Soon after I returned here to GA from TX, we all took off to the woods to a camp near Cartersville, GA.  This is where we've had to relocate all of our training camps for the World Race as we've outgrown our headquarters here in Gainesville.  The camp was full of 200+ World Racers who are taking the first step on this journey around the world.  It was a great week, Racers were prepared and equipped, God was at work in BIG ways speaking to his children, and we all enjoyed some incredible worship led by Jonathan Helser and his band. 

  

Right after training camp, I made a quick trip up to Tennessee to see Mom & Dad who were spending some time enjoying Fall in a place where Fall is beautiful!  Sorry West Texas, you got nothing on these fall colors around here.  :)  Mom, Dad, and I had a weekend together seeing the sites & enjoying the crisp Fall weather.  

Immediately after this weekend, hundreds of people started pouring into Gainesville, where we would host a big conference for all AIM staff and alumni and extended family of AIM.  The entire weekend was full of incredible worship (again led by the Helser team), challenging teachings, and tons of reconnecting time with the "family" that had gathered. 

Now you see why WHIRLWIND is a word used often this past month.  It's busy, but it's absolutely life giving.  I love what I do and who I get to do life with here.
